The area of rectangle whose dimensions are 25 cm by 1 m is

Respuesta :

wegnerkolmp2741o
wegnerkolmp2741o wegnerkolmp2741o
  • 02-04-2020

Answer:

2500 cm^2

Step-by-step explanation:

The units are not the same

Changing 1 m to cm

1m * 100cm/1m = 100 cm

A = l*w

   = 25cm * 100 cm = 2500 cm^2
